JOB SUMMARY

The Business Development Representative is responsible for promoting D2L Products and Services, establishing customer relationships, and providing qualified, motivated leads to the Sales teams. As a key member of the sales team, the successful candidate will have in-depth knowledge of the company’s solutions, competition, and a keen interest in the eLearning industry. The primary market focus is the education and corporate sectors.

We are looking for an energetic, polished individual with exceptional communication skills and a talent for relationship building. The successful candidate will gain expertise in accurately capturing and qualifying leads, effectively managing a sales pipeline, and achieving quarterly revenue targets.

This Business Development Representative provides a challenging career opportunity as well as career advancement within D2L.

HOW WILL I MAKE AN IMPACT?
  • Responsible for exceeding objectives within your assigned territory
  • Able to understand and deliver D2L's unique value proposition and create solution vision with prospects
  • Actively participate in outbound calling campaigns to generate sales opportunities
  • Accurately capture and qualify leads gathered from tradeshows, webinars, inbound calls, and other marketing initiatives
  • Follow-up with existing D2L contacts and develop them into sales prospects
  • Distribute leads and make qualified appointments for Sales Executives
  • Monitor and respond to D2L Sales inbox and website inquiries – responding and re‑directing incoming customer request for information, etc.
  • Create and update lead generation emails and phone scripts
  • Update customer interactions through the CRM tool
  • Complete sales reports and present findings to executive management
  • Conduct market research and keep updated on product and industry knowledge, competitors, and industry knowledge
  • Represent D2L at occasional tradeshows; some travel will be required
WHAT YOU’LL BRING TO THE ROLE
  • Interest in pursuing a sales career within a fast‑paced, constantly changing environment
  • Pro‑active and goal oriented with the ability to maintain consistent levels of customer activity to generate sales leads and meet achieve quarterly objectives
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Excellent time management skills with the ability to multi‑task and organize/prioritize work independently
  • Strong interpersonal and customer orientation skills with the ability to influence decision makers
  • Demonstrated ability to work individually and collaboratively within a team environment
  • Previous experience in eLearning, the education sector, enterprise software and/or high tech solutions providers preferred
  • Degree or diploma in Business, Marketing or related
  • AI Skills: Experience using AI‑powered sales engagement and CRM tools to optimize prospecting and outreach. Ability to leverage AI tools to accelerate email drafting, lead research, and outreach personalization. Comfortable interpreting AI‑generated insights and using them to prioritize outreach and follow‑up. Curious mindset with a passion for experimenting with tools that improve workflow efficiency, including AI‑based solutions.
